Abstract
The invention provides an intelligent curtain control system based on ZigBee. The intelligent curtain control system comprises a displacement detection module, a ZigBee transceiving and control module, a display module and a motor drive module. The displacement detection module is used for measuring the movement distance of a curtain and judging the open and close state of the curtain. The displacement detection module is in communication with the ZigBee transceiving and control module used for sending a curtain control instruction, receiving a curtain control instruction and receiving the open and close state signal, sent by the displacement detection module, of the curtain. The ZigBee transceiving and control module is connected with the motor drive module used for receiving the control signal sent by the ZigBee transceiving and control module and driving a motor drive circuit. The ZigBee transceiving and control module is further connected with the display unit used for displaying mistake information and curtain close and open state information. The problem of complex wiring is solved through the wireless remote control technology; meanwhile, multiple curtain control circuits can be expanded and are managed in a centralized mode and distributed on curtains of all rooms, and intelligence of curtain control is greatly improved.

Technical field
The present invention relates to a kind of curtain Controller, particularly relate to a kind of Intelligent window curtain control system based on ZigBee.
Background technology
Curtain is as a kind of articles for daily use, most employing Non-follow control, curtain rail is all steel wire rope hand pulling type or pulley-type, only the family of some booming income adopts is electric remote control track, but prices are rather stiff, can not popularize, design the multifunctional curtain of a use managed by micro computer, wireless remote control, comply with the development of demand in market.
Existing remote-controlled curtain wiring is complicated, lacks curtain and user profile interactive function, or complex structure, and exist and control the shortcomings such as reliability is low, therefore, its occupation rate of market is low, and most of family still adopts common curtain.
Summary of the invention
For solving the problem, the invention provides a kind of Intelligent window curtain control system based on ZigBee, its employing wireless telecontrol engineering, solve the problem that wiring is complicated, simultaneously, can expand multiple curtain control circuit, centralized management is dispersed in the curtain in each room, greatly improves the intelligent of curtain control.
The present invention is by the following technical solutions:
Based on an Intelligent window curtain control system of ZigBee, comprise displacement detection module, ZigBee transmitting-receiving and control module, display module and motor drive module;
Described displacement detection module is for measuring the displacement of curtain, judge the on off state of curtain, displacement detection module and for sending curtain control instruction, the ZigBee of the switch state signal receiving curtain control instruction and receive the curtain that displacement detection module sends receives and dispatches and control module communication, ZigBee transmitting-receiving is connected with the motor drive module receiving and dispatching control signal and the drive motors drive circuit sent with control module for receiving ZigBee with control module, ZigBee transmitting-receiving is also connected with the display unit for showing error message and Curtain switch status information with control module,
Described ZigBee transmitting-receiving comprises signal transmitter unit, signal receiving unit and control unit with control module.
Further, described displacement detection module is range sensor.
Further, described ZigBee transmitting-receiving adopts CC2530 chip with control module.
Further, the described Intelligent window curtain control system based on ZigBee and the communication of multiple Curtain switch control circuit, for realizing the centralized Control of disperseing curtain.
Apply the above-mentioned Intelligent window curtain control system based on ZigBee, the autocontrol method realizing curtain is:
S1, user send the order opening or closing curtain by signal transmitter unit, signal receiving unit receives the order opening or closing curtain, and command signal is transferred to control unit;
S2, control unit send control signal, receive the Curtain switch status signal that displacement detection module sends, whether consistent judge that current curtain on off state and user arrange state according to Curtain switch status signal;
If the current curtain on off state of S3 and user arrange state consistency, then control unit returns rub-out signal, and rub-out signal exports at display unit; If it is inconsistent that current curtain on off state and user arrange state, then control unit exports control signal, control signal drive motors driver module, performs user to the switch-linear hybrid of curtain, meanwhile, by the display of Curtain switch state on the display unit.
Beneficial effect: the application of ZigBee Radio Transmission Technology controls with indoor curtain by the present invention, realizes short-distance wireless and controls the function of curtain from folding, bringing great advantage to the user property; Structure of the present invention is simple, and be easy to upgrading, control accuracy is high, and reliability is strong, easy to use, is easy to management.
